What Is Hidden Memories Mobile Game?

At its core, Hidden Memories is a mobile puzzle RPG with strong story-driven mechanics. Think of it like if Life is Strange had a baby with Monument Valley and raised it on American road trip nostalgia and emotional side quests.

You’re playing a nameless character who jumps between fractured memories of strangers (or are they really strangers?), solving layered logic puzzles to restore timelines, unlock secrets, and uncover this eerie meta-narrative that, honestly, gets darker the further you go. I won’t spoil anything, but let’s just say: Chapter 7 changes things.

It’s free on both iOS and Android, and it exploded in the U.S. over the last year thanks to TikTok clips, Reddit fan theories, and a few high-profile influencer streams. If you haven’t touched it yet, you’ll find it under Hidden Memories on the App Store or Google Play.

How to Redeem Hidden Memories Codes (iOS & Android)

Okay, so this part should be easy—and mostly it is—but I still see people digging around in the wrong menu. If you’re like me and you skip tutorials? Slow down here for a sec.

On Android & iPhone:

  1. Open Hidden Memories and tap the gear icon in the top-right (Settings).
  2. Scroll down to Account > Redeem Code.
  3. Paste the code into the field (case-sensitive, no extra spaces).
  4. Hit Submit and your reward pops up instantly.

If it doesn’t? You probably:

  • Used an expired code (double-check that date)
  • Entered a fake code (see the scam warning below)
  • Have already redeemed it on another device/account

There’s no “are you sure?” prompt, by the way. Once it’s in, it’s in.

Top Rewards You Can Unlock with Codes

So what’s the point of hunting all these codes? Well, the free stuff isn’t just fluff. Some of it matters—especially if you’re pushing through late-game chapters.

Here’s a personal breakdown:

Reward Type Why It Matters
Memory Tokens Needed to unlock “deep memories” in Chapters 5+
Energy Boosters Lets you chain 3–4 puzzles in a row without hitting cooldown
Rare Skins Some have passive buffs—like faster clue refreshes
Legendary Unlocks I got the Shattered Self skin this way—crazy lore reveal
Item Crates Randomized gear that sometimes includes event-only charms

What I’ve found is that stacking codes near the end of a chapter lets you breeze through boss-level puzzles without waiting for cooldowns. It’s not pay-to-win—but it’s definitely code-to-sprint.

Community Tips: Maximize Code Use

A few tricks from the trenches:

  • Wait to redeem until you’re low on energy—don’t waste it when you’re already full.
  • Stack codes before event days (usually Fridays or Mondays) so you can double dip with quest chains.
  • Refer friends: They’ve quietly added a combo bonus if you and a referral redeem within the same 48 hours.
  • Guild Bonuses: If your whole guild redeems the same code, it sometimes unlocks a group reward. Didn’t know that until mine did it by accident.
  • Time your redemptions: Some codes trigger in-game cutscenes or limited quest lines you can miss if you’re not in the right chapter.

Basically, if you treat codes like part of your strategy instead of random freebies, you’ll get a lot more out of them. That’s something I learned after treating them as “just cosmetic stuff” for way too long.
